Trick Interpretations and Concepts



To understand the distinctions between guaranty agreement bonds and insurance policy, it's necessary to realize vital meanings and ideas.

Guaranty contract bonds are a three-party agreement where the surety guarantees the performance of a legal responsibility by the principal to the obligee. The principal is the party that acquires the bond, the obligee is the event that needs the bond, and the surety is the party that assures the performance.

Insurance, on the other hand, is a two-party agreement where the insurer accepts compensate the guaranteed for given losses or damages for the repayment of premiums.

Unlike insurance, surety contract bonds do not supply monetary defense to the principal. Rather, they give guarantee to the obligee that the principal will certainly meet their legal commitments.

Application and Authorization Process



Once you have decided on the type of coverage you require, the following action is to recognize the application and approval procedure for getting guaranty contract bonds or insurance coverage.

For surety contract bonds, the procedure commonly entails sending an application to a surety firm together with appropriate economic records and project information. The guaranty company will certainly examine your economic strength, experience, and online reputation to establish if you're eligible for bond insurance coverage. This process can take a couple of weeks, relying on the intricacy of the project and the guaranty firm's work.

On the other hand, obtaining insurance policy normally involves submitting an application form and offering standard details regarding your service. The insurer will certainly evaluate the risk related to your organization and offer a quote based on that analysis. The approval process for insurance coverage is typically quicker compared to surety contract bonds.
